qcacmn: Featurize WMI APIs and TLVs that are specific to WIN

In the existing converged component, WMI TLV APIs are implemented in
a generic manner without proper featurization. All the APIs exposed
outside of WMI are implemented in wmi_unified_api.c and all the APIs
forming the CMD or extracting the EVT is implemented in wmi_unified_tlv.c.

Since WIN and MCL have a unified WMI layer in the converged component and
there are features within WIN and MCL that are not common, there exists a
good number of WMI APIs which are specific to WIN but compiled by MCL and
vice-versa. Due to this inadvertent problem, there is a chunk of code and
memory used up by WIN and MCL for features that are not used in their
products.

Featurize WMI APIs and TLVs that are specific to WIN
- Air Time Fareness (ATF)
- Direct Buffer Rx (DBR)
- Smart Antenna (SMART_ANT)
- Generic WIN specific WMI (AP)

+#ifndef _WMI_UNIFIED_ATF_PARAM_H_
+#define _WMI_UNIFIED_ATF_PARAM_H_
+
+#define 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_CLIENTS   50
+#define 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_ATFGROUPS 16
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_peer_info - ATF peer info params
+ * @peer_macaddr: peer mac addr
+ * @percentage_peer: percentage of air time for this peer
+ * @vdev_id: Associated vdev id
+ * @pdev_id: Associated pdev id
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	struct wmi_macaddr_t peer_macaddr;
+	uint32_t percentage_peer;
+	uint32_t vdev_id;
+	uint32_t pdev_id;
+} atf_peer_info;
+
+/**
+ * struct bwf_peer_info_t - BWF peer info params
+ * @peer_macaddr: peer mac addr
+ * @throughput: Throughput
+ * @max_airtime: Max airtime
+ * @priority: Priority level
+ * @reserved: Reserved array
+ * @vdev_id: Associated vdev id
+ * @pdev_id: Associated pdev id
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	struct wmi_macaddr_t peer_macaddr;
+	uint32_t     throughput;
+	uint32_t     max_airtime;
+	uint32_t     priority;
+	uint32_t     reserved[4];
+	uint32_t     vdev_id;
+	uint32_t     pdev_id;
+} bwf_peer_info;
+
+/**
+ * struct set_bwf_params - BWF params
+ * @num_peers: number of peers
+ * @atf_peer_info: BWF peer info
+ */
+struct set_bwf_params {
+	uint32_t num_peers;
+	bwf_peer_info peer_info[1];
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_peer_ext_info - ATF peer ext info params
+ * @peer_macaddr: peer mac address
+ * @group_index: group index
+ * @atf_index_reserved: ATF index rsvd
+ * @vdev_id: Associated vdev id
+ * @pdev_id: Associated pdev id
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	struct wmi_macaddr_t peer_macaddr;
+	uint32_t group_index;
+	uint32_t atf_index_reserved;
+	uint16_t vdev_id;
+	uint16_t pdev_id;
+} atf_peer_ext_info;
+
+/**
+ * struct set_atf_params - ATF params
+ * @num_peers: number of peers
+ * @atf_peer_info: ATF peer info
+ */
+struct set_atf_params {
+	uint32_t num_peers;
+	atf_peer_info peer_info[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_CLIENTS];
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_peer_request_params - ATF peer req params
+ * @num_peers: number of peers
+ * @atf_peer_ext_info: ATF peer ext info
+ */
+struct atf_peer_request_params {
+	uint32_t num_peers;
+	atf_peer_ext_info peer_ext_info[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_CLIENTS];
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_group_info - ATF group info params
+ * @percentage_group: Percentage AT for group
+ * @atf_group_units_reserved: ATF group information
+ * @pdev_id: Associated pdev id
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	uint32_t percentage_group;
+	uint32_t atf_group_units_reserved;
+	uint32_t pdev_id;
+} atf_group_info;
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_grouping_params - ATF grouping params
+ * @num_groups: number of groups
+ * @group_inf: Group informaition
+ */
+struct atf_grouping_params {
+	uint32_t num_groups;
+	atf_group_info group_info[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_ATFGROUPS];
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_group_wmm_ac_info - ATF group AC info params
+ * @atf_config_ac_be: Relative ATF% for BE traffic
+ * @atf_config_ac_bk: Relative ATF% for BK traffic
+ * @atf_config_ac_vi: Relative ATF% for VI traffic
+ * @atf_config_ac_vo: Relative ATF% for VO traffic
+ * @reserved: Reserved for future use
+ */
+struct atf_group_wmm_ac_info {
+	uint32_t  atf_config_ac_be;
+	uint32_t  atf_config_ac_bk;
+	uint32_t  atf_config_ac_vi;
+	uint32_t  atf_config_ac_vo;
+	uint32_t reserved[2];
+};
+
+/**
+ * struct atf_grp_ac_params - ATF group AC config params
+ * @num_groups: number of groups
+ * @group_inf: Group informaition
+ */
+struct atf_group_ac_params {
+	uint32_t num_groups;
+	struct atf_group_wmm_ac_info group_info[ATF_ACTIVED_MAX_ATFGROUPS];
+};
+
+enum {
+	W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_DISABLED = 0,
+	W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_ENABLED  = 1,
+};
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_PEER_AST_IDX(token_info) \
+	(token_info.field1 & 0xffff)
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_USED_TOKENS(token_info) \
+	((token_info.field2 & 0xffff0000) >> 16)
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_UNUSED_TOKENS(token_info) \
+	(token_info.field2 & 0xffff)
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_SET_PEER_AST_IDX(token_info, peer_ast_idx) \
+	do { \
+		token_info.field1 &= 0xffff0000; \
+		token_info.field1 |= ((peer_ast_idx) & 0xffff); \
+	} while (0)
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_SET_USED_TOKENS(token_info, used_token) \
+	do { \
+		token_info.field2 &= 0x0000ffff; \
+		token_info.field2 |= (((used_token) & 0xffff) << 16); \
+	} while (0)
+
+#define WMI_HOST_ATF_PEER_STATS_SET_UNUSED_TOKENS(token_info, unused_token) \
+	do { \
+		token_info.field2 &= 0xffff0000; \
+		token_info.field2 |= ((unused_token) & 0xffff); \
+	} while (0)
+
+/**
+ * struct w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_info
+ * @field1: bits 15:0   peer_ast_index  WMI_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_PEER_AST_IDX
+ *          bits 31:16  reserved
+ * @field2: bits 15:0   used tokens     WMI_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_USED_TOKENS
+ *          bits 31:16  unused tokens   WMI_ATF_PEER_STATS_GET_UNUSED_TOKENS
+ * @field3: for future use
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	uint32_t    field1;
+	uint32_t    field2;
+	uint32_t    field3;
+} w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_info;
+
+/**
+ * struct w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_event
+ * @pdev_id: pdev_id
+ * @num_atf_peers: number of peers in token_info_list
+ * @comp_usable_airtime: computed usable airtime in tokens
+ * @reserved[4]: reserved for future use
+ * @w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_info token_info_list: list of num_atf_peers
+ */
+typedef struct {
+	uint32_t pdev_id;
+	uint32_t num_atf_peers;
+	uint32_t comp_usable_airtime;
+	uint32_t reserved[4];
+	w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_info token_info_list[1];
+} wmi_host_atf_peer_stats_event;
+
+#endif /* _WMI_UNIFIED_ATF_PARAM_H_ */
